The Yorkie Poo is a hybrid breed that combines the characteristics of 2 popular pet breeds: the Yorkshire Terrier Welpen Von Privat Yorkshire Terrier Mini Welpen and the Poodle. This mix generally results in a small pet dog that is both playful and caring. Generally weighing between 4 to 15 pounds and standing about 7 to 15 inches tall, the Yorkie Poo is well-suited for home living and families with children.

When looking for a Yorkie Poo breeder, it's vital to ensure they are accountable and ethical. Here are some pointers to assist you find a reliable breeder:
Red Flags to Watch ForWarningDescriptionPoor Living ConditionsBreeders that keep dogs in dirty or cramped conditions are likely less responsible.Lack of Health TestingA good breeder needs to perform medical examination on their reproducing dogs to avoid genetic problems.No ReferencesA trustworthy breeder will have recommendations or reviews from previous consumers.High Volume of LittersBeware of breeders who produce lots of litters at the same time; they might focus on earnings over canine well-being.Questions to Ask BreedersCan I see the puppy's moms and dads?What health screenings have been performed on the moms and dads?What socialization practices do you use for your puppies?Can you supply referrals from previous puppy purchasers?What kind of health assurance do you provide?Comprehending the Breeding Process
An accountable breeder will prioritize the health and temperament of their dogs. They usually follow these steps:
Health Checks: All parent dogs go through health screenings to recognize possible genetic conditions.Socialization: Puppies are raised in a revitalizing environment with exposure to different sights, sounds, and experiences.Proper Nutrition: Breeders offer a balanced diet plan for both the mom and her puppies, guaranteeing healthy growth and development.Early Veterinary Care: Puppies receive preliminary vaccinations and health check-ups before being put in their brand-new homes.Taking care of Your Yorkie Poo
Yorkie Poos are fairly low-maintenance dogs, however they still need correct care to prosper. Here are some necessary care suggestions:
Grooming NeedsRegular Brushing: Brush your Yorkie Poo's coat at least two to three times a week to avoid tangles and mats.Bathing: Bathe your pup every couple of weeks or as needed, using a gentle pet hair shampoo.Professional Grooming: Many owners choose to take their Yorkie Poos to professional groomers for hairstyles and nail trimming every couple of months.Health ConsiderationsHealth IssueDescriptionOral ProblemsRegular oral care is vital; think about oral chews or brushing.Luxating PatellasThis knee problem can happen in small types, monitor your pet for limping.Allergic reactionsKnow food and environmental allergic reactions; consult your vet for solutions.Training and ExerciseStandard Obedience Training: Start training your Yorkie Poo as early as possible to develop etiquette.Daily Exercise: Although they are small, Yorkie Poos need regular workout to stay healthy and pleased. Objective for at least 30 minutes of playtime or strolls each day.Regularly Asked Questions1. How much do Yorkie Poos cost?
The cost of a Yorkie Poo can differ commonly depending on the breeder, place, and lineage. On average, you can expect to pay between ₤ 1,000 and ₤ 2,500.
2. Are Yorkie Poos good with children?
Yes, Yorkie Poos are usually excellent with kids due to their playful and affectionate nature. Nevertheless, supervision is recommended, specifically with younger kids.
3. How frequently should I groom my Yorkie Poo?
Grooming frequency depends on the coat type. A Yorkie Poo with a curly coat may require more regular grooming than one with a straight coat. Go for a minimum of every 2-3 weeks.
4. Do Yorkie Poos have health problems?
Like all types, Yorkie Poos might acquire specific hereditary health issues. Regular veterinary care and health screenings from the breeder can help reduce these dangers.
